Cracking or Peeling Surface Areas



When the paint on your home's exterior starts to exhibit breaking or peeling surfaces, it suggests a need for focus and maintenance to maintain the home's aesthetic charm. Splitting happens when the paint film splits open, commonly looking like a dried-up riverbed, while peeling off happens when the paint loses its bond to the surface beneath it.

These problems not just diminish the aesthetics of your home yet also compromise the defense the paint provides against the components.

Splitting and peeling surface areas can be brought on by different variables such as inadequate surface area prep work before painting, use low-grade paint, exposure to severe weather conditions, or simply the all-natural aging of the paint. Ignoring these indications can lead to more damage to the hidden surface areas, potentially causing a lot more substantial and pricey repair services in the future.

To resolve splitting or peeling off surfaces, it is essential to remove the loose paint, sand the location, apply a guide, and paint the afflicted areas. By taking timely action to remedy these problems, you can maintain your home's exterior appeal and safeguard it from potential wear and tear.

Mold and mildew, Mildew, or Rust Spots



Indicators of mold, mold, or rust spots on your home's exterior can indicate a need for removal to avoid more degeneration and maintain the home's overall appearance. Mold and mildew and mold grow in wet environments, frequently looking like dark areas or spots on the walls. These not just interfere with the aesthetic allure of your house however additionally present health hazards to passengers.

Corrosion areas, generally discovered on steel surface areas like railings or seamless gutters, signify oxidation and can bring about structural weakening if left unchecked. Dealing with these issues without delay is essential to avoid a lot more comprehensive damage to your home.

To take on mold and mold, complete cleaning with specialized services and proper ventilation are important. Rust places require scraping off the rust, treating the steel, and applying a protective finish. Ignoring these indicators not just endangers the look of your home yet can also result in expensive repairs down the line.

Regular examination and upkeep can aid protect your home's exterior and prolong its life expectancy.
